Hey, sorry you are struggling. I also often want to be a kid again. I was thinking about it the other day. One of the most therapeutic things I did last year was to go to a park near my house and swing on the swings there. Another thing that is great is to grab a teddy bear and cuddle up under a big blanket or duvet. Let yourself be a kid sometimes. Its great if someone is there but you can do things alone too - like play in the mud even or paint with your fingers. Hang in there. Growing up is tough, but you can do it - and you don't have to be grown up all the time.

Ashlie - do you have support or anyone you can talk to? Breaking up is very hard and you can feel very lonely. Make sure you look after yourself - eat and get enough sleep. But most importantly have someone you can talk to. Take care.
